How can I increase the transactions-per-second (TPS) allowed by the service?
The free (S0) tier only allows 20 transactions per minute. Upgrade to the S1 tier to get up to 20 transactions per second. If you're seeing the error code 429 and the "Too many requests" error message, submit an Azure support ticket to raise your TPS to 50 or higher with a brief business justification. The service is throwing an error because my image file is too large. How can I work around this?
The file size limit for most Azure Vision features is 4 MB for the 3.2 version of the API and 20MB for the 4.0 version, and the client library SDKs can handle files up to 6 MB. For more information, see the Image Analysis input limits.
Can I send multiple images in a single API call to the Azure Vision service?
This function isn't currently available.

Can I deploy the OCR (Read) capability on-premises?
Yes, the Azure Vision 3.2 OCR (Read) cloud API is also available as a Docker container for on-premises deployment. Learn how to deploy
